## Build Provenance: Kronafix Rounding Saga

Quick recap for the weekly sync: the Kronafix converter was rounding half-cents differently across builds because the rounding mode got baked in at compile time from a locale flag. Fun! The fix pins banker's rounding everywhere, and provenance now records the flag so we can trace which builds shipped the sloppy math. If you're auditing old invoices from the Velmarsh pilot, check the build stamp first. The current verified token is below.

session token of bahip-hawep = htk4_b0c1

Meeting Notes — Key-card Stock, Thistledown Site (excerpt)

Quick recap from Tuesday: the blank key-card stock for the new Thistledown site finally cleared QA, so we're good to ship. Roughly 400 blanks, boxed in four sealed cartons, plus the encoder unit. Marnie flagged that nothing goes out until Records logs carton seals against the issue register — please do that first thing. Courier pickup is set for Thursday morning at the loading hatch. For the actual hand-over, everyone agreed to follow the confidential instruction recorded below.

handover note for yagef-bagep: the drudor pelius courier leaves the kasdor zorvan norir ledger at gate 8016 under passcode 755406

**Runbook 9.1 — Account Recovery, Nightly Reindex (Lanternsearch).** Support team: if the lanternd service account is locked out, the nightly search reindex will silently skip and search results go stale within 24 hours. Do not create a new account — this orphans the index lease. Instead, open the Quillmere recovery console, select the lanternd principal, and choose "restore from passphrase." The console then requires the recovery passphrase noted directly below.

recovery phrase for tawef-hawif: praiel-novvan-frador-soriel-novath-pelath

Notes from the Thursday catch-up on the Dunmore catalogue import. Good news: the ingest pipeline finally handles the weird legacy encoding from the Averton branch records. Less good: import jobs still run with a shared service account, which security flagged — we'll scope it down before the next batch. Audit logging is on for all write paths now. Any access or credential questions should go to the import lead:

approver of yafog-kajog = Ralael Quenmir